Tele Aid*
Tele Aid*
Tele Aid* incorporates the following
functions:
Emergency call system
Roadside Assistance
Information
For certain emergency situations, the
system automatically triggers an
emergency call. An emergency call can
also be triggered manually by pressing the
corresponding button. Refer to your
vehicle Operator’s Manual for additional
information.If the system initiates an emergency call,
Connecting
and theß symbol will
appear on the status bar. All active
connections are terminated.
During the emergency call,
Call
Connected
appears on the status bar. No
operation from COMAND is possible, so
you cannot disconnect the emergency call.Roadside Asssistance will assist if
technical problems with your vehicle are
experienced.
Roadside Assistance can be requested
manually by pressing the corresponding
button. Refer to your vehicle Operator’s
Manual for additional information.
Upon request of Roadside Assistance, the
system initiates the call to the Assistance.
Connecting
and theß symbol will
appear on the status bar. All active
connections are terminated except
Emergency call.

156 ServiceTele Aid*If the connection is made, the message Call
Connected
appears on the status
bar.
During activation of a Roadside Assistance
call, it is not possible to switch to another
application, but you can initiate an
Emergency call, if necessary.Terminating the connection
Press K.
COMAND reverts to the system last
active before Tele Aid was activated.
A call to the Response Center will be
initiated by pressing the corresponding
button. Information regarding the opera-
tion of your vehicle, the nearest authorized
Mercedes-Benz Center or Mercedes-Benz
USA products and services is available to
you. Refer to your vehicle Operator’s Man-
ual for additional information.
When an information call is initiated,
Connecting
and theß symbol will
appear on the status bar. All active
connections are terminated except
Emergency call and Roadside Assistance
call.When the connection is made, the
message
Call
Connected
appears on
the status bar.
During activation of an Information call, it
is possible to switch to another application
and initiate an Emergency call or Roadside
Assistance call, if necessary.

166 GlossaryPIN code
Your PIN code prevents unauthorized
persons from using your GSM mobile
phone. The PIN code is a number
string, which you have to enter when
switching on the telephone.
Provider
is the network operator who makes
available (provides) telephone services
Roaming
For this function, the telephone uses
the telephone network of a contract
partner. There are home type and non-
home type systems. The ROAMING
indicator in the COMAND display indi-
cates that a call is being made using a
non-home type system.

Tele Aid*
(Tele
matic A
larm I
dentification on D
e-
mand)
The Tele Aid system consists of three
types of response: automatic and ma-
nual emergency, roadside assistance,
and information. Tele Aid is initially
activated by completing a subscriber
agreement and placing an acquain-
tance call. Refer also to the vehicle
operating instructions.The Tele Aid system is operational pro-
vided that the vehicle’s battery is char-
ged, properly connected, not damaged,
and cellular and GPS coverage is avai-
lable.
